Need to Recreate Docker.img
I've been having all sorts of stability problems with Unraid, which after a lot of research seemed to be a corrupted docker.img file. I read online that if docker.img is deleted it's automatically re-created upon reboot, but that's not happening for me. I tried disabling and re-enabling docker in Settings and neither work - I also checked the /system/docker/ location where the image should be and there's nothing there. There's a thread on this from years ago but unfortunately none of the information here helped me: Appreciate any guidance!

[Support] joshgaby-tor-relay
That was it! Thanks so much for your feedback. Turns out I didn't even have ipv6 enabled on the server at all (and for some reason the option to enable ipv6 was greyed out and unavailable). Adding the correct ipv4 address to torrc fixed it and now the app runs.
